Spring Swim Camp Week 8 - Recap on Sculling, Timing
18-04-2010
This weeks session was a recap on what happens under the water, with more focus on sculling and getting the feel for the water.Fist Drill - swim with your hands closed into fists, focus on your forearm 'catching' the water. This drill is great for your balance. Swim normally after this drill and you should really get a good feel for the water.
Catch Up Drill - hold your leading hand extended out on front, hold it there while the other arm performs a normal stroke. Your two hands should meet in front, then hold opposite arm out in front and stroke normally with the other arm. This drill is great to isolate aspects of your stroke, but is very effective for the push phase of the stroke.
Timing - one hand enters as the other begins the push phase, one hand exits before or as the other hand begins pulling. Keep your stroke even, count in an even rhythm 1,2,3,4. Its a good idea to count at the end of your stroke so as to emphasize the push phase.
